Output 877449416ac785fb25b4f9bfbc550813741cfc97ac1b4bb46fb4702686e37162:0

value
2102593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cf5104ceccd1bf814227ba667ffbbad4dbad0af OP_EQUAL
address
34L8REjSDVBQoFbMxGc4qLYJBU1g9aCNg4
transaction
877449416ac785fb25b4f9bfbc550813741cfc97ac1b4bb46fb4702686e37162
confirmations
167020
spent
true